CHIRK Cricket Club has confirmed its weekend fixture has been rearranged after a Covid-19 outbreak.

Six players for the Shropshire County Cricket League side have tested positive for the virus, and are said to be ‘doing ok at the moment’.

The side was set to face Bomere Heath on Saturday as they looked to build on a strong start to the season which has put them in third place in the Division One table.

A spokesman posted on the Chirk Cricket Club Twitter page: “Due to a covid outbreak, our first team game is cancelled tomorrow vs @BomereHeathCC.

“Six lads that are isolating are all doing okay at the moment.

“Thankfully they have agreed to rearrange the fixture so working on that in the coming days.”
